Ministry of Faith Formation

Liturgy of the Word for Children

Program for children age 3 through Grade 4 on Sunday mornings during the 10:30 am Mass.

Teacher or Substitute Grades 1-5

Works with the children in Grades 1-5 in the Faith Formation Program.  In-services are held regularly.  Class materials provided.  Grades 1 & 2 meet from 4:30-5:30 at the Darboy campus.  Grades 3-5 meet from 4:45-5:45 at the Kimberly campus.  Classes are held on Wednesdays;
September through April.

Teacher or Substitute Grades 6-8

Works with the children in Grades 6-8 in the Faith Formation Program.  In-services are held regularly.  Class materials provided.  Classes meet Wednesdays, 6:30-7:45 pm., at the Darboy campus, September through April.

Teacher Grades 9-11

Works with the students in grades 9-11 am.  Courses are held for six week periods,  four quarters during the school year.  Classes meet at various times during the week.  Catechists volunteer for one course at a time.

Catechist Training

Five catechist in-services are held throughout the year.  Catechists are offered opportunity, through these in-services, to grow in their knowledge of the Catholic Faith and to develop their teaching skills.  A catechist retreat is held during Holy Week.

Adult Bible Study

Two Bible study groups meet at the Darboy campus on Tuesdays, September through May.  One group meets at 9:00 am; the other group meets at 6:30 pm.  Three groups meet on Thursdays at the Kimberly campus.  A women’s group meets at 9:00 am throughout the year.  A men’s group meets at 9:00 am, September through May.  Another women’s group meets at 9:30 every other week, September through May.

Adult Education Program

Every Lent our parish offers a series of classes on a particular theme.  Guest speakers are invited to conduct the sessions.  The program takes place on Sunday afternoons at the Darboy campus.

Third Source Funding Efforts

A Committee dedicated to raising funds to supplement the educational programs of Faith Formation.  Major focus during the year includes the Annual Campaign for Education, and “We Care” Program at Pick N’ Save.

Annual Campaign for Education

This annual drive invites alumni, parishioners and corporate givers to direct a contribution to one of four educational programs (1) Holy Spirit School (2) Faith Formation
(3) Youth Ministry or (4) Father Fuller Endowment.

“We Care” Program at Pick N’ Save

People who shop at Pick N’ Save and use the Savers Club Membership Card can stop at the customer service desk and name their charity as Holy Spirit Faith Formation.  A
percentage of their spending will be given to our program. Checks are issued quarterly by Pick N’ Save.
